Objectives
The students make use in this practical course of the knowledge about
enzymes and their properties by using them in enzymatic analytical methods
and in simulations of industrial processes.
Topics
Several immobilisation methods are performed with the use of different types
of reactors.
The properties of immobilized enzymes are compared with these of the free
enzymes.
The role of enzymes in process control and in analytical methods are
investigated.
Prerequisites
Profound knowledge of enzymology (course thirth year).
